840,000 private tenants in England and Wales could be behind on rent

Landlords’ group calls for more government help because of Covid ‘debt crisis’

More than 800,000 private tenants in England and Wales could be behind on their rent, with young people and the self-employed most likely to have missed payments, research for a landlords group has found.

The National Residential Landlords Association (NRLA) warned of a “rent debt crisis” and called for government action to help struggling tenants.
